BPO Process Outsourcing: Optimizing Your Company's Processes for Effectiveness and Achievement

Updated: Dec 28, 2023

Not all businesses have enough staff or budget to handle essential functions such as accounting, IT, sales, and customer support.

If you are one of them, you can outsource those tasks to a third-party service provider known as BPO.

They are generally a B2B (business to business) services provider who saves you time and money by doing your backend and essential tasks on your behalf.

In this blog, we will walk through the key benefits of BPO, tasks to be handed over to BPO, challenges, and other things. Let’s get started.

Understanding BPO in Simple Terms


Business Process Outsourcing (BPO) is like hiring a third party or another company to do specific tasks for your business.

Instead of doing everything in-house, you let a third party take care of certain functions. This third party handles all the tasks related to that function, making your business more efficient.

For example, you don’t have the expertise in register your company or staff to handle your payroll. Therefore, you hire a third party or a specialist company to do those tasks for you.

This way, you don’t need to hire a staff to do payroll. This is simply outsourcing your payroll to a specific provider.

Likewise, you can outsource your other tasks such as IT, customer support, and sales to an outside provider instead of getting it done by your in-house team.


Understanding the Key Benefits of BPO


Cost Savings:


Businesses can avoid the high costs of recruiting and training in-house staff by outsourcing non-core functions.

Because BPO companies benefit from economies of scale, they can deliver specialized services for a fraction of the price of what it would cost to keep an internal workforce. It can be beneficial for small and medium-sized businesses looking to make the most of their resources on a limited budget.


Focus on Core Competencies:


When non-essential tasks are handed over to external experts, your in-house team can have more focus on core business activities.

This enables your company to nurture innovation, improve product or service quality, and ultimately gain a competitive edge.

Access to Global Talent Pool:


Whether its customer support, IT services, or data management, you can tap into the expertise of professionals with a variety of skill sets and experiences across the globe.

This global reach allows for 24/7 operations, ensuring that your business is not bound by time zones and can cater to customers on a round-the-clock basis.

Scalability and Flexibility:


As businesses grow and evolve, so do their needs. BPO offers a level of scalability and flexibility that is unparalleled.

Efficient BPO partners can modify services to your requirements, whether you need to scale up during busy times or decrease during slow ones.

Focus on Customer Satisfaction:


By outsourcing tasks like customer support to seasoned professionals, you can ensure a consistently high level of service.

BPO providers are dedicated to meeting customer expectations, allowing your business to build a reputation for reliability and excellence in customer interactions.

Technological Advancements:


By partnering with a BPO, your business can leverage these technological advancements without the need for significant upfront investments, ensuring that you remain at the forefront of innovation.

What You Can Outsource to Your BPO Provider


While there are many tasks you can outsource, some of the common areas where BPO can help you with the most are… 

Business Registration:

BPO services for business registration can assist in everything from obtaining the necessary licenses and permits to ensuring compliance with local regulations. Outsourcing this process allows businesses to save valuable time and resources while ensuring they adhere to all legal requirements.


BPO services in taxation can handle tasks such as preparing tax returns, managing tax deductions, and staying abreast of changes in tax laws. By outsourcing taxation processes, businesses can ensure accuracy and compliance, allowing them to focus on strategic business initiatives.


You can get a range of accounting tasks outsourced, including bookkeeping, financial reporting, and auditing. Outsourcing accounting processes not only ensures precision in financial data but also provides businesses with real-time insights into their financial health.


BPO services for payroll can handle tasks such as salary calculations, tax withholding, and compliance with labor laws. Outsourcing payroll processes allows businesses to avoid errors, ensure timely salary disbursements, and stay compliant with ever-changing labor regulations.

Visa Services:

For businesses operating on a global scale, managing visa processes for employees can be a daunting task. BPO services specializing in visa processing can navigate the complexities of immigration laws, ensuring that employees have the necessary documentation to work in different regions. This not only saves time but also reduces the risk of legal complications related to immigration.

Choosing the Right BPO Partner




Choose a BPO provider with a track record of success in your industry. Look for expertise and experience in the specific processes you plan to outsource.



Effective communication is vital for a successful outsourcing relationship. Ensure the BPO provider understands your company culture, goals, and expectations.



Based on your company's needs, a competent BPO partner should be able to scale its services. This adaptability is necessary to support expansion or modify services during times of financial hardship.

Security Procedures:


Ask about the security precautions used by the BPO provider, considering the sensitivity of the data involved. Make sure they have strong security measures in place to safeguard your data.

Realizing the Full Potential of BPO


Once you've selected a reliable BPO partner, it's time to integrate the outsourcing process seamlessly into your operations.

Regular communication and feedback are key. Treat your BPO provider as an extension of your team, fostering a collaborative environment.


Set Clear Expectations:


Establish clear expectations from the outset. Clearly define the scope of work, performance metrics, and timelines to avoid misunderstandings.

Track Performance:


Keep a close eye on your BPO partner's performance regularly. This entails evaluating key performance indicators (KPIs) and quickly resolving any problems.

Continuous Improvement:


Encourage a culture of continuous improvement. Regularly review processes and look for opportunities to optimize and enhance efficiency further.

Embrace Technology:


Leverage technology to facilitate seamless collaboration. Use project management tools, communication platforms, and other technologies to ensure efficient workflow.

Understanding and Overcoming Common BPO Challenges


While BPO can offer numerous benefits, it's not without its challenges. However, with careful planning and effective management, these challenges can be overcome.

Cultural Differences:


Working with teams from different cultural backgrounds may pose challenges. Foster a culture of openness and understanding to bridge these gaps.

Quality Control:


Maintaining consistent quality across outsourced processes is critical. Implement robust quality control measures and regularly audit the performance of your BPO partner.

Security Concerns:


Address security concerns by implementing strict data protection measures and ensuring that your BPO partner adheres to industry standards.

The Bottom Line:


Business Process Outsourcing is a powerful tool that can propel your company to new heights of efficiency and success. You may streamline your operations, cut expenses, and concentrate on what matters—providing outstanding goods and services to your clients—by carefully outsourcing non-core tasks.

Remember, the key to a successful BPO partnership lies in careful selection, clear communication, and a commitment to continuous improvement. So, go ahead, explore the world of BPO, and unlock the full potential of your business!


